  5. quick answer......... no :thumbsup: the ke55 ke70 have a larger tailshaft yoke on the auto, your tailshaft wont fit 30,55,70 run an internal uni clip, your car has external uni cips, you can't swap the yokes you could get a tailshaft made, use the 55 or 70 shifter, and it should go straight in, but i havent done it so don't take that as gospel vacume thingy is so your gear box knows when to shift down from low manifold vacume (unlike kick down cable to shift down when you floor it)
  6. they are special "anti tamper" bolts, the heads snap off when the bolts are at the right tork, get them out but tapping them anti clockwise with a center punch, then cut a groove in the tops with a hack saw, then you can tighten them up with a flat head screw driver :thumbsup:

  18. black dash ke30 had a banjo, silver dash had the borg warner ke30 through 55 had leaf springs, ke70 had trailing arms no the diffs complete will not interchange, and unless you have all the tools for setting backlash and shimming a borg warner the diff shop price ($400 usualy) makes a center swap a bloody expencive option
